Who was Gregor Mendel?
The Mendel is considered the father of Genetics. He was a monk, botanist and biologist born in Austria in 1822 and who died in 1884. Throughout the years 1853 to 1863 he cultivated pea plants in the gardens of his monastery to be used in his research. His experiments consisted of the crossing pea plants of distinct characteristics (size, color of the seeds, and so on.), cataloging the results and interpreting them. The experiments guide him to enunciate his laws, results published in 1886 with no scientific repercussion at that time. Merely at the beginning of the 20th century, in 1902, 18 years after his death, were his merits broadly recognized.
